steam games suddenly have very low fps
so as the title says, i have an issue with fps in steam games only.

i've been playing baldur's gate 3 and dragon age inquisition on ultra graphics with very smooth fps and getting no issues at all, but then this morning baldur's gate 3 decided that 2 fps was all it could do. i tried putting the graphics to their lowest, and still, 2 fps was the maximum. the audio plays like normal and the cursor shows no lag either and moves smoothly, as usual, so i'm just??? huh??? i tried opening dai to see if it also ran at 2 fps after that, and yep, it did. just to make sure it wasn't just those two, i tried running danganronpa trigger happy havoc next, and it ran at 9 fps, which is a bit better than 2 fps, but still. bruh. so then i tried opening genshin impact, which isn't a steam game, and it ran smooth as butter, so????

I have a small todo list i do everytime i have issues with my GPU (probably do number 3 first, i had a similar issue that was resolved by doing that and its the easiest to do)

1. DDU

2. rollback drivers

3. Open the NVIDIA Control Panel by right-clicking on your desktop and selecting "NVIDIA Control Panel."
Navigate to the 3D settings and confirm that the power management mode is set to "Prefer maximum performance."
Additionally, ensure that all other settings and optimizations are at their default values to eliminate any conflicting configurations.
